Business
Microchip Technology Inc. is a leading provider of smart, connected and secure embedded control solutions, including microcontrollers, mixed-signal, analog and Flash-IP integrated circuits; 8-, 16- and 32-bit PIC and AVR microcontrollers; digital signal controllers; microprocessors; analog power management and conversion devices; CAN and LIN serial communication interfaces; high-voltage MEMS and piezoelectric drivers; ultrasound multiplexers; embedded controllers; memory products such as serial EEPROM, SRAM, flash, NvSRAM, EERAM, parallel EEPROM, one-time programmable flash and CryptoMemory; wireless connectivity solutions including Wi-Fi, Bluetooth and Ethernet; FPGAs and SoCs; PMICs; timing, communication and real-time clock products; USB devices; and development tools, reference designs and software including MPLAB IDE and AI coding assistants. Headquartered in Chandler, Arizona, the company was founded in 1989 as a spin-off from General Instrument's microelectronics division and operates wafer fabrication facilities in Gresham, Oregon, and Colorado Springs, Colorado, with assembly and test sites in Thailand and the Philippines; it serves industrial, automotive, consumer, aerospace and defense, communications and computing markets worldwide, targeting over 125,000 customers with a fab-lite model blending in-house production and external foundries. Recent developments include the acquisition of Neuronix AI Labs to enhance AI-driven edge solutions on FPGAs and VSI Co. Ltd. to expand automotive networking with ASA Motion Link technology; expansion of its India footprint with a new Bengaluru office facility to support over 3,000 employees and IC development; new product launches such as the MCP9604 high-accuracy thermocouple IC, radiation-tolerant FPGAs with 50% power savings, cost-optimized PolarFire Core FPGAs and SoCs with 30% price reduction, a 3 nm PCIe Gen 6 switch for AI infrastructure, and partnerships including TSMC for 40nm manufacturing resilience and Delta Electronics on silicon carbide solutions; enhanced AI coding assistant with agents for productivity gains; and raised financial guidance for December 2025 quarter sales representing 12% year-over-year growth.
